Reviewer notes: this release moves the Orsten API tier from per-process pools to the shared Deepwell pooler. Verify the pool sizing math in `pool_config.yaml` — max connections must not exceed the Fennmark replica's limit minus the reserved maintenance slots (currently 12). Roll nodes one at a time, watching saturation and checkout-wait metrics for at least ten minutes each. Rollback is a config revert plus a pooler restart. The pooler only accepts configuration pushes signed by the release pipeline, using the key below.

rollout seal: bky4_x7Gc

Welcome to on-call for the Glimmerpane design system! Our snapshot tests live in the `snapcheck` suite and run on every merge to main. If a UI component changes visually, the diff bot flags it — usually it's an intentional tweak, so just approve the new baseline. If it's 2am and snapshots are failing across the board, it's almost always a font-loading race, not your problem. To unlock the baseline store and re-approve snapshots in bulk, use the recovery passphrase below.

recovery phrase for tahag-taguf: wenix-caswyn

Q: How do we run load tests against the Cartwright checkout flow without touching production? A: Use the shadow environment, which mirrors the payment stubs and inventory snapshots nightly. Ramp virtual shoppers from 50 to 2,000 over ten minutes and watch the p95 latency dashboard. Abort if error rates exceed two percent. Results are archived to the sealed perf bucket after each run, and for the weekly sync only leads should open it. To decrypt the archive, use the passphrase shown directly below.

vault phrase of hahop-badug = novvan-ulaion-zorius-noviel-gorwyn-casix-tamys

Step 4: Patch the image cache in Glimmerbox 2.7. Earlier builds retained decoded bitmaps past eviction, causing unbounded heap growth under sustained thumbnail traffic. The fix enforces a hard byte ceiling and weak references for inactive entries. From a review standpoint, note that eviction events are now logged without payload data. The post-migration cache settings we applied are listed below.

config for kagup-hahig:
druwyn:
  pin: 2801
  metrics_host: metrics.druwyn.zemvarlabs.internal
  tenant: sorius
  seal: seal_798a43d7